Technical Field
[0001] This application belongs to the technical field of oil well equipment, specifically relating to a ball-suspended jet unblocking device. Background Technology
[0002] Oil is mainly stored in the pores of rock strata, forming oil reservoirs. During oil extraction, pipelines need to be inserted into the oil reservoirs to extract the oil stored there. The area of the oil reservoir close to the pipeline is called the near-wellbore zone. Oil from the non-near-wellbore zone reaches the pipeline through the pores in the near-wellbore zone via permeation.
[0003] In the process of oil and gas development, as reservoir development progresses, maintaining good seepage in oil and water wells requires effectively addressing seepage and contamination issues in the near-wellbore area. With the extension of the oil well production cycle, reservoirs often encounter operational damage during development, leading to contamination and blockage around the wellbore, resulting in excessively high injection pressure in water injection wells and severely impacting the injection-production balance. Furthermore, over-balanced drilling causes early contamination of the oil layer by drilling and completion fluids upon encountering it. Even worse, a significant number of oil wells experience substantial drilling fluid loss upon encountering the oil layer, leading to pore blockage and hindering stable oil production.
[0004] In the process of unclogging oil and water wells, a hydraulic jet unclogging device is usually lowered into the target formation in the well. The high-pressure water jet from the nozzle carries the agent and is directed towards the well wall and the near-well rock formation, moving axially. The rotator drives the jet unclogging device to rotate, achieving the rotational jetting of high-pressure water to remove scale and unblock the blockage. However, the spherical connection between the rotating shaft and the rotating sleeve of the rotator results in a low rotational speed, which in turn reduces the efficiency of unclogging. [0033] Reference Figures 1-7 As shown in the embodiment of this application, a ball-suspended jet unblocking device is provided, including an anchor unit 1, a rotating unit 2, a jet unblocking unit 3, and a pressurizing unit 5, wherein:
[0034] One end of the anchoring unit 1 is connected to the rotating unit 2, and the other end is connected to the oil pipe. It is used to anchor the anchoring unit 1 to the casing wall when the oil pipe pressure rises to a preset pressure value. Anchor claws 102 are evenly distributed on the circumferential surface of the anchoring unit body 101. The anchor claws 102 are in their original state due to the action of the internal elastic element (the teeth of the anchor claws 102 are not higher than the anchoring unit body 101). Through internal pressure, the anchor claws 102 extend outward under the action of the hydraulic pressure generated by the internal and external pressure difference. The teeth of the anchor claws 102 are embedded in the casing wall, restricting the up and down movement of the tool and realizing the anchoring of the tubing. After the internal and external pressure difference of the tool is eliminated, the anchor claws 102 are reset under the elastic force of the internal spring between the baffle and the anchor claws 102, and the anchoring is released.
[0035] The rotating unit 2 includes a rotating head 202, a rotating sleeve 203, and multiple suspended balls 205. The rotating head 202 and the rotating sleeve 203 are both hollow cylinders. The rotating head 202 and the rotating sleeve 203 are nested together and an annular groove is formed between them. The multiple suspended balls 205 are disposed in the annular groove. The multiple suspended balls 205 are evenly distributed in the annular groove, which can better and more evenly distribute the axial tension between the rotating head 202 and the rotating sleeve 203. The width and depth of the annular groove are slightly larger than the diameter of the suspended balls 205. The suspended balls 205 can rotate freely in the annular groove and can connect the rotating head 202 and the rotating sleeve 203, so that there is no large range of axial relative movement between the rotating head 202 and the rotating sleeve 203.
[0036] The two ends of the jetting unblocking unit 3 are respectively connected to the rotating unit 2 and the pressurizing unit 5. The jetting unblocking unit 3 includes a first inner cylinder 304, an upper connector 301, and an outer protective cover 303. The upper connector 301 is sleeved on the first inner cylinder 304, and the outer protective cover 303 is sleeved on the upper connector 301. The upper connector 301 and the first inner cylinder 304 are provided with a fluid channel. The flow channel includes a slit 3011 in the upper connector 301 and a flow channel hole 3041 in the upper inner cylinder 304. The outer protective cover 303 is provided with a jetting hole 3031, which is connected to the fluid channel. After the jetting fluid enters the tubing, it flows from the flow channel hole 3041 in the upper inner cylinder 304 into the annulus between the first inner cylinder 304 and the upper connector 301, and then flows through the slit 3011 in the upper connector 301 into the jetting hole 3031 to jettison the perforations on the casing and the near-wellbore area.
[0037] The pressurization unit 5 includes a central tube 503 and a pressurizer 509. The inner wall of the central tube 503 is provided with a first positioning protrusion 5031, and the outer wall of the pressurizer 509 is provided with a second positioning protrusion 5091. The pressurizer 509 is placed in the central tube 503, such that the second positioning protrusion 5091 fits against the first positioning protrusion 5031 to seal the central tube 503 and achieve the purpose of pressurization.
[0038] The ball-suspended jet unblocking device proposed in this application embodiment is formed by nesting and connecting the rotating head 202 and the rotating sleeve 203, with an annular groove between them. Multiple suspended balls 205 are disposed in the annular groove, which satisfies the axial tensile force of the device and keeps the rotating head 202 and the hydraulic anchor unit 1 stationary. At the same time, the form of the suspended balls 205, compared with the spherical surface structure in the prior art, reduces the contact area, allowing the rotating sleeve 203 and the jet unblocking unit 3 and the pressurizing unit 5 below the rotating sleeve 203 to rotate at high speed, thereby improving the efficiency of jet unblocking.
[0039] In some optional embodiments, the outer wall of the rotating head 202 is provided with a first groove 2021, and the inner wall of the rotating head 202 is provided with a placement hole 2022 communicating with the first groove 2021, the placement hole 2022 allowing the suspended ball 205 to pass through; the rotating sleeve 203 is provided with a second groove 2031, the first groove 2021 and the second groove 2031 are combined to form the annular groove; the rotating unit 2 further includes a set screw 206, the set screw 206 is used to be placed in the placement hole 2022 to block the placement hole 2022 after the suspended ball 205 is placed in the annular groove. The first groove 2021 and the second groove 2031 are joined together to form the annular groove. Part of the suspended ball 205 is located in the first groove 2021 and the other part is located in the second groove 2031, thereby connecting the rotating head 202 and the rotating sleeve 203 without affecting their rotation. There are two placement holes 2022, which are located at the top and bottom of the annular groove, respectively. The suspended ball 205 is placed into the annular groove through the placement holes 2022. After all the suspended balls 205 are placed into the annular groove, the placement holes 2022 are connected to the set screw 206 to block the placement holes 2022 and prevent the suspended balls 205 from leaking out of the placement holes 2022.
[0040] In some optional embodiments, the injection holes 3031 are spirally distributed on the outer protective cover 303, and the axis of the injection holes 3031 forms an acute angle with the radial direction of the outer protective cover 303. The acute angle between the axis of the injection holes 3031 and the radial direction of the outer protective cover 303 can be understood as the axis of the injection holes 3031 not being parallel to the radial direction of the outer protective cover 303. The ejected fluid from the injection holes 3031 forms an acute angle with the circumferential direction of the outer wall of the outer protective cover 303, creating a thrust on the outer protective cover 303. Under the action of the ejected fluid, the entire injection unblocking unit 3 will generate a tangential force perpendicular to the axial direction of the tubing, causing the injection unblocking unit 3 to rotate axially, thus enhancing the effect of the injection unblocking operation.
[0041] In some optional embodiments, the rotating unit 2 further includes a tubing coupling 201 and a variable thread connector 204. The tubing coupling 201 is connected to the anchoring unit 1 and the rotating head 202, respectively, and the variable thread connector 204 is connected to the rotating sleeve 203 and the upper connector 301, respectively. The connection between the rotating unit 2 and the anchoring unit 1 is achieved through the tubing coupling 201 connecting to the anchoring unit 1 and the rotating head 202, and the connection between the rotating unit 2 and the injection unblocking unit 3 is achieved through the variable thread connector 204 connecting to the rotating sleeve 203 and the upper connector 301, all of which are threaded connections.
[0042] In some optional embodiments, the jet unblocking unit 3 further includes a gasket 302, a second inner cylinder 306, and a lower connector 305. The second inner cylinder 306 is embedded in the upper connector 301 and abuts against the first inner cylinder 304, limiting the axial movement of the first inner cylinder 304 and maintaining coaxiality. The lower connector 305 is connected to the upper connector 301, and the inner wall of the lower connector 305 is provided with a positioning step 3051. The end face of the positioning step 3051 abuts against the end face of the second inner cylinder 306, thereby limiting the axial movement of the first inner cylinder 304 and maintaining coaxiality. The inner cylinder 306 is positioned, and the end of the lower connector 305 away from the upper connector 301 is connected to the pressurizing unit 5; there are two gaskets 302, which are respectively set between the end face of the outer cover 303 and the end face of the upper connector 301, and between the end face of the outer cover 303 and the lower connector 305. The gaskets 302 can adjust the gap between the connecting surfaces, making the connection tighter, and at the same time, they can buffer the connecting surfaces, avoid wear of parts, and improve the service life of the device.
[0043] In some optional embodiments, the pressurization unit 5 further includes a first connector 501, a second connector 510, a shear ring 504, and a sliding sleeve 507. The first connector 501 and the second connector 510 are respectively connected to both ends of the central tube 503. The first connector 501 is connected to the lower connector 305. The shear ring 504 and the sliding sleeve 507 are sleeved on the central tube 503. The shear ring 504 is connected to the central tube 503 by a shear pin 505. One end face of the sliding sleeve 507 abuts against the end face of the shear ring 504, and the other end face of the sliding sleeve 507 abuts against the end face of the second connector 510. The central tube 503 is provided with a pressure relief hole 5033, which is blocked by the sliding sleeve 507. The second connector 510 is connected to the central tube 503 by a locking pin 508, and the shear ring 504 is connected to the central tube 503 by a shear pin 505. One end face of the sliding sleeve 507 abuts against the end face of the shear ring 504, and the other end face of the sliding sleeve 507 abuts against the end face of the second connector 510. Both the shear ring and the second connector 510 are fixed, so that the sliding sleeve 507 cannot move. The pressure relief hole 5033 is blocked by the sliding sleeve 507. The booster 509 is placed behind the central tube 503 to seal the central tube 503 and achieve the purpose of boosting pressure.
[0044] In some optional embodiments, a first annular space 511 is provided between the sliding sleeve 507 and the outer wall of the central tube 503, and a water-permeable hole 5032 communicating with the first annular space 511 is provided on the central tube 503. When the pressure of the central tube 503 is sufficient to shear the shear pin 505, the shear ring 504 and the sliding sleeve 507 slide upward, exposing the pressure relief hole 5033, thereby balancing the internal and external pressures of the central tube 503. By continuing to pressurize the oil pipe, the fluid in the central tube 503 enters the first annular space 511 through the water-permeable hole 5032. When the fluid pressure in the central tube 503 is sufficiently high, the fluid entering the first annular space 511 shears the shear pin 505, and the shear ring 504 and the sliding sleeve 507 slide upward, exposing the pressure relief hole 5033, thereby balancing the internal and external pressures of the central tube 503, maintaining stable pressure, preventing the pressure of the tubing from becoming too high, ensuring the safety of the tubing, and improving the safety of the device.
[0045] In some embodiments, the central tube 503 is further provided with a blocker 506, which is located in the water permeable hole 5032. The blocker 506 is used to control the flow rate of the jet fluid, thereby controlling the pressure. In addition, it can filter the jet fluid, so that the jet fluid has a better jetting effect and improves the efficiency of jetting and unblocking.
[0046] In some optional embodiments, the outer wall of the central tube 503 is provided with a first limiting protrusion 5034, and the inner wall of the sliding sleeve 507 is provided with a second limiting protrusion 5071. The shear ring 504 and the sliding sleeve 507 slide upward until the second limiting protrusion 5071 abuts against the first limiting protrusion 5034. By having the second limiting protrusion 5071 abut against the first limiting protrusion 5034, the upward movement of the shear ring 504 is limited, preventing the shear ring 504 from moving excessively and pressing against the first connector 501, thus improving the stability and reliability of the device.
[0047] In some optional embodiments, the pressurization unit 5 further includes a return spring 502, which is disposed on the central tube 503 and located between the upper connector 301 and the shear ring 504. The return spring 502 is compressed and accumulates a rebound force during the upward sliding of the shear ring 504. When the thrust driven by the flow pressure of the central tube 503 is less than the rebound force, the rebound force causes the shear ring 504 and the sliding sleeve 507 to slide downward, closing the pressure relief hole 5033. The return spring 502, disposed between the upper connector 301 and the shear ring 504, ensures pressure balance between the annulus inside the tubing and the casing, maintaining stable pressure and preventing excessively low pressure in the tubing string, thus ensuring the safety of the tubing string and improving the safety of the device.
[0048] In some optional embodiments, the ball-suspended jet unblocking device further includes a connecting section 4, the two ends of which are connected to the lower connector 305 and the first connector 501, respectively. By setting the connecting section 4 and adjusting its length, it can adapt to unblocking oil wells of different lengths, improving the versatility of the device. In addition, if there are multiple blockage locations, two or more jet unblocking units 3 can be set as needed, and the connecting section 4 can be used to connect them, improving the unblocking effect and efficiency of the device.
[0049] The working principle of the ball-suspended jet unblocking device is as follows: Before construction, the booster unit 5, connecting section 4, jet unblocking unit 3, rotating unit 2, and anchoring unit 1 are inspected at the wellhead and connected from bottom to top via threaded connections. After installation and connection, it can be manually confirmed whether the rotating head 202 and rotating sleeve 203 can rotate flexibly. During construction, the work-in-progress machine lowers the ball-suspended jet unblocking device into the well to the layer requiring jet unblocking via the tubing string. Then, the surface plunger pump is started to inject clean water into the tubing for well flushing until clean liquid returns from the wellbore, at which point well flushing is stopped. Then, the booster 509 is inserted into the tubing. After the booster 509 reaches the designated position inside the pressure booster valve of the sliding sleeve 507 (i.e., the second positioning protrusion 5091 is in contact with the first positioning protrusion 5031), the surface plunger pump starts pressurizing to 20MPa. When the pressure inside the tubing... When the force increases, the anchor unit 1 will fix the device string to the casing wall to prevent displacement during operation; the jet fluid will be injected through the jet unblocking unit 3 to unblock the perforations and near-wellbore area on the casing; under the action of the jet fluid, the entire jet unblocking unit 3 will generate a tangential force perpendicular to the axis of the tubing string, causing the jet unblocking unit 3 to rotate axially, enhancing the effect of the jet unblocking operation; when the pressure in the tubing is too high due to continuous pressurization by the ground plunger pump, the sliding sleeve 507 on the pressurization unit 5 will move upward, opening the pressure relief hole 5033 to relieve the pressure of the fluid in the tubing, so as to balance the pressure between the tubing and the annulus in the casing, maintain pressure stability and tubing string safety; when the jet unblocking operation is completed, the ground plunger pump stops pressurizing, and the wellhead pressure is depressurized to 0MPa. At this time, the tubing and tool string can be pulled out using the workover rig, and the tools can be retrieved.
